The J-Tech Digital 4K 30Hz 4x4 HDMI Matrix Switcher delivers professional-grade AV distribution with 4 inputs and 4 outputs, supporting 4K UHD video and advanced HD digital audio formats. Featuring remote control capabilities and built-in signal optimization, it ensures seamless, high-quality transmission for gaming consoles, Blu-Ray players, and satellite receivers.

My original matrix worked really really well for approx 8 months, but then for no apparent reason, Output 1 failed entirely... Then approx 4 weeks later, Output 2 failed entirely. All 4 Inputs still worked fine. I contacted J-Tech via Amazon, and they quickly agreed to replace the matrix under the 1-year mfr warranty. I shipped the defective unit (at my own cost) to them on 7/5/2018, and the replacement arrived on 7/13/2018. I just plugged in the replacement unit, and it had a complete power failure after only 15 minutes. It worked perfectly for those 15 minutes, and then nothing......... all power dead, which is an entirely different problem from the first unit which I just returned. When working, I give the 4x4 matrix 4 Stars for OPERATION(the screen blackout on all outputs while switching sources is the only significant complaint), but the fact that 2 channels failed in 8 months would lead me to give it 1-2 Stars at best for DURABILITY. Good product for HD resolutions, not for live situations
Like other reviews indicate, all the screens blink when you switch any input or output, likely because all the input and output signals have to resynch, which is why it loses a star. This switcher is therefore not useful for live situations. However, for my purposes, it is acceptable, and most importantly, it is so far, reliable. It's at its optimal when running strictly HD resolution (1920x1080), or when all outputs and inputs are all running at the same resolution. It does not do scan conversion, so when you have monitors that have different resolution limitations, the incompatible output will not work. I was reluctant to buy this product, but after dealing with the excellent J-Tech customer service for an hdmi audio extractor that gave me a lot of problems (which I eventually returned for a refund), I felt confident to try one of their other products. And I am glad I did. The unit does have a few quirks. The unit can get a little hot when it has all 4 ins and outs in operation. When the is no power to the unit (power strip off) the lights will sometimes briefly blink. That's a weird thing. When doing video capture through it, sometimes there's artifacts in the video, if you're trying to monitor your capture in a different monitor. If you switch off the monitor feed and only have one output going to your capture card, the artifacts go away. Anyhow, I would recommend to go directly from your source to your capture card, for a more stable signal.

For the last 5 years I used a separate 4x1 input device connected to a 1x4 output device. It was rudimentary but cheap for my experiment in distributing HDMI to monitors spread throughout a large home. Runs are anywhere from 6 feet to 60 feet. At least one of those boxes stopped working so I researched replacements. This time I was willing to spend the big bucks but this reasonably priced device seemed to accomplish what I needed and more as a matrix (any source to any display) versus just a repeater of the same signal to all displays. So far it works great. My only complaint is the display is not quite right (can't see the game score), nor as clear (lower resolution) as if I connect a display direct to a source. That may be due to having one 720p in with 3 1080p displays. Typically the lowest resolution trumps all, this box seems to be no exception. One of these days I'll upgrade the 720p and hopefully see improvement across the matrix. Regardless, I hope this box lasts at least as long as my last experiment.
